1. 域名

在万网购买,略

2. 云服务器

阿里云购买,略

3. 安装lnmp

使用lnmp.org程序,略

4. 申请证书

阿里云-管理控制台-安全(云盾)-证书服务-购买证书
证书类型: 免费型DV SSL
选择品牌: Symantec

购买成功后,绑定域名,配置DNS解析记录生效

5. 配置HTTPS服务器

Nginx的安装目录下创建cert目录
下载证书,放到cert目录
修改nginx.conf文件,加入443端口及证书目录

server
{
listen 80;
listen 443 ssl;
#listen [::]:80;
server_name cet.fangbei.org;
index index.html index.htm index.php default.html default.htm default.php;
root /home/wwwroot/cet.fangbei.org; include none.conf;
#error_page 404 /404.html;
include enable-php.conf; ssl_certificate /usr/local/nginx/cert/214130435490250.pem;
ssl_certificate_key /usr/local/nginx/cert/214130435490250.key; location ~ .*\.(gif|jpg|jpeg|png|bmp|swf)$
{
expires 30d;
} location ~ .*\.(js|css)?$
{
expires 12h;
} location ~ /\.
{
deny all;
} access_log off;
}

重启lnmp即可。

6. 使用https访问网站

支持80端口和443访问

http://cet.fangbei.org/

https://cet.fangbei.org/

https访问时,可以看到证书

7. 参考链接

https://www.jianshu.com/p/1a792f87b6fe

https://www.chinassl.net/ssltools/generator-csr.html

https://ssltools.godaddy.com/views/csrDecoder

最新文章

  1. BufferedReader与BufferedWriter读写中文乱码问题
  2. mac下安装 xampp 无法启动apache (转,留用)
  3. Android 判断SIM卡属于哪个移动运营商
  4. IIS 7.5 高并发参数配置
  5. jquery动态移除/增加onclick属性详解
  6. placeholder调整颜色
  7. [置顶] Android项目组织和代码重用
  8. <context:component-scan>
  9. 五子棋AI大战OC实现
  10. 获取windows任务栏高度的方法
  11. HDU1754 I hate it(线段树 单点修改)
  12. macos 常用快捷键及操作
  13. 深浅copy
  14. TCC细读 - 3 恢复流程
  15. java标号
  16. ASP.NET MVC 手机短信验证
  17. SharePoint 2013 设置customErrors显示实际的错误信息
  18. Tkinter Anchors(锚)
  19. macbook pro 2016 2017 15寸 雷电3 外接显卡 epu 简单教程(不修改UEFI)
  20. 微信小程序中的app文件介绍

热门文章

  1. 译文《最常见的10种Java异常问题》
  2. 大牛带你学会java类加载机制,不要错过,值得收藏!
  3. FreeBSD 宣布 2020 年第 4 季度状态报告
  4. 关于深度学习配置的一些tips
  5. Python装饰器(3)
  6. MyBatis(十一):MyBatis架构流程浅析
  7. 2019 南京网络赛 B super_log 【递归欧拉降幂】
  8. css实现京东顶部导航条
  9. 攻防世界 reverse 进阶 9-re1-100
  10. LookupError: 'hex' is not a text encoding; use codecs.decode() to handle arbitrary codecs